我们的PROD环境目前使用ReCAPTCHA Enterprise Key + Legacy密钥,仍然使用“站点验证”来验证用户的分数。
我们计划迁移到评估功能以及附加功能(例如 11 个分数级别)。
所以我想知道如果Google启用了这个功能,会:
非常感谢!
Siteverify 是一个 reCaptcha v3 端点,用于验证 reCaptcha 小部件的令牌发送的响应是否有效,只能给出 0 到 1 之间的分值(而 0 看似由机器人生成的响应,1 代表有效的人类反应)。评估是 reCaptcha 企业版中 siteverify 的增强功能,可通过利用各种分数级别(最高 11)进行更复杂的行为分析。因此,即使您已将 reCaptcha 升级到企业版,如果您使用 siteverify 端点,您也只能使用 0 到 1 之间的分数级别。[1][2]
从 reCaptcha(v2 或 v3)迁移到 reCaptcha enterprise:
如本官方文档中所述,关于将非企业版 reCaptcha 迁移到 reCaptcha Enterprise
从 reCAPTCHA 的非企业版迁移到 reCAPTCHA Enterprise 涉及从 reCAPTCHA 管理控制台选择活动站点密钥并迁移站点密钥。您可以迁移一个或多个活动站点密钥。但是,您一次只能迁移一个站点密钥。
因此,您可以在企业版 reCaptcha 中使用与非企业 reCaptcha 相同的密钥。
迁移到 reCaptcha Enterprise 是否会影响站点验证端点的响应?
迁移到 reCaptcha Enterprise 不会影响非企业 reCaptcha 中可用的任何功能,例如 siteverify。它仅检查响应是否有效,并进一步调查无效响应的原因。
参考资料:
[1] https://developers.google.com/recaptcha/docs/v3#site_verify_response [2]https://cloud.google.com/recaptcha-enterprise/docs/interpret-assessment-website#interpret_assessment